When you look into SBA loan costs, keep in mind that the final numbers depend on a few key moving parts. Lenders analyze your specific business cash flow, your personal credit history, and the total amount you need to borrow. The length of the repayment term and the current interest rate environment also play significant roles in your monthly commitment. Your SBA loan payment is the amount you pay back to the lender on a monthly basis. These payments are typically spread over several years, which keeps the monthly cost manageable compared to shorter-term debt. You should understand your payment schedule before signing any agreement so it fits within your projected cash flow. For an SBA 7(a) loan in McAllen, you must operate a for-profit business. You'll need to have invested some of your own capital. A good credit history is essential. The loan must be for a legitimate business purpose. You must also meet SBA size standards.
SBA loans are loans partially guaranteed by the U.S. Small Business Administration. For McAllen businesses, this means easier access to capital with potentially better terms than traditional loans. The SBA doesn't lend money directly. They reduce lender risk, encouraging more lending to small businesses. We help you find these options.
